  • Abstract
    This paper first investigates the effect of electrolyte concentration on the characteristics of the MEMS based electrochemical seismic sensors by experimental method. Testing for the frequency response and sensitivity of the sensor were carried out and experimental results were discussed. Then the relationships between the characteristics and the electrolyte concentration of the sensor are illustrated. It is demonstrated that the characteristics of the seismic sensor depends on the concentration of I2 mostly.
